SDS President Filipche Surprised by MP Petrovska's Move, No Expulsion Considered
The leader of the Social Democratic Union of Macedonia (SDS), Venko Filipche, expressed surprise regarding the decision of Member of Parliament Slavjanka Petrovska to join the initiative "Conversations for the Future at 12:05". Filipche stated that he did not anticipate Petrovska taking this step without prior consultation. Despite his surprise, Filipche asserted that the party is not considering expelling Petrovska. He suggested that Petrovska may have fallen under some influence, leading to her actions. The comments were made in an interview with "Sloboden Pecat".
